Output 9902324720691bf77ea3ad979d928a23903ac1dedf598e160861029b240f7d9a:7

value
414362
script pubkey
OP_0 OP_PUSHBYTES_20 e8eecaec8e8d9374eacda9e15ce88eb22aee3cd1
address
bc1qarhv4myw3kfhf6kd48s4e6ywkg4wu0x305cgd5
transaction
9902324720691bf77ea3ad979d928a23903ac1dedf598e160861029b240f7d9a
spent
true